I suspect tint laws are going to become much more prevalent in the future. Why? When the local constabulary pull a car over and cannot see what the occupants are doing, they get very nervous. Case in point, I was driving our family minivan (with factory tint on the rear side doors and the full rear of the van) on a vacation, full with adult professionals including a lawyer, and we got pulled over for "Following too close". When the officers approached, one on either side of the van, very close to the sides, and each with a hand on the butt of their side-arms, I knew they were very nervous. The passenger who was a lawyer happened to be riding shotgun that day and she and I both told the four passengers in the rear, put your hands up on the headrests in front of you so the officers can see them.
